
Salted Chocolate Fondue
Here is a secret about this recipe: it looks fancy and tastes great, but it's actually oh so quick and easy to make. It lends itself to other uses as well – along with using it to dip fruit into, you can also drizzle it over Sunday morning waffles or pancakes! Serve with fresh banana or berries, or add some ground hazelnuts for that divine choc-hazelnut combo.
Recipe Tester Feedback: “The fondue was beautiful and glossy. It was just right in terms of saltiness – it took away the bitterness of the chocolate and helped to offset the sweetness." - Nerine
No: Gluten / Egg / Nuts
Contains: Dairy
Preparation Time 8 minutes
Cooking Time 5 minutes
Serves 8
Cannot be frozen
You will need:
knife
chopping board
spatula
skewers, to serve
Ingredients
- fruit of choice - fresh, chopped into bite-size pieces
- Dip:
- chocolate - 200g, dark, broken up into small pieces
- double cream - 150g
- vanilla - 1 tsp, extract
- salt flakes - 1.5 tsp
- Variations:
- waffles - or pancakes, to serve instead of fruit
- hazelnuts - ground, to add to the dip
Method
- Add the dark chocolate pieces (200g), double cream (150g) and vanilla extract (1 tsp) into the bowl. Program 5 minutes / 70C / Speed 1.
- Add the salt flakes (1.5 tsp) to the bowl. Mix Speed 5 / 10 seconds.
- Allow the fondue to cool slightly to thicken up, then serve with fruit and skewers for dipping.
